What are the differences between linear and curvilinear motion? |

Ans : The differences between linear and curvilinear motion are as follows:
1. Linear motion follows a straight path, while curvilinear motion follows a curved or non-linear path.
2.Linear motion has a constant direction, whereas curvilinear motion changes direction.
3.Examples of linear motion include a car moving in a straight line or a ball rolling down a slope. Curvilinear motion examples is a person walking along a curved path.
